The Biological Clock: Understanding Female Fertility Decline
Female fertility is a complex interplay of hormones, ovarian reserve, and overall health. Unlike men, women are born with a finite number of eggs—approximately one to two million at birth. This number steadily diminishes over time, both in quantity and quality. By puberty, the egg count drops to around 300,000 to 400,000, and only about 400 to 500 will be ovulated during a woman’s reproductive lifespan.
The decline in fertility begins subtly in the late 20s but becomes more pronounced after age 35. This period marks the start of what many call the “biological clock.” The ovaries’ ability to release healthy eggs decreases, increasing the chances of infertility, miscarriage, or chromosomal abnormalities in offspring.
Hormonal fluctuations accompany this decline. Levels of follicle-stimulating hormone (FSH) rise as the ovaries become less responsive, signaling reduced ovarian reserve. At the same time, estrogen and progesterone levels fluctuate unpredictably, affecting menstrual cycles and ovulation regularity.
Menopause: The Definitive End Point
Menopause is medically defined as the cessation of menstruation for 12 consecutive months without other causes. It typically occurs between ages 45 and 55, with the average age being around 51. Menopause marks the end of natural fertility because it signifies that the ovaries have stopped releasing eggs.
However, fertility doesn’t suddenly vanish at menopause; it gradually wanes during perimenopause—the transitional phase leading up to menopause. During perimenopause, irregular cycles and hormonal imbalances make conception increasingly difficult.
What Age Can Women Stop Having Kids? Fertility Milestones by Decade
Knowing how fertility changes across decades helps clarify when women generally stop being able to conceive naturally.
| Age Range | Fertility Status | Notes |
|---|---|---|
| 20-29 years | Peak Fertility | Highest chance of conception; low risk of miscarriage or chromosomal abnormalities. |
| 30-34 years | Slight Decline | Still fertile but egg quality starts to decrease; pregnancy rates slowly drop. |
| 35-39 years | Moderate Decline | Fertility drops more steeply; increased miscarriage risk; genetic testing often recommended. |
| 40-44 years | Significant Decline | Natural conception becomes challenging; IVF success rates decline; miscarriage rates rise. |
| 45+ years | Rare Natural Conception | Natural pregnancies are uncommon; menopause approaches or occurs; assisted reproduction often needed. |
This table highlights that while some women can conceive naturally into their early 40s, chances are slim past that point without medical assistance.
The Role of Assisted Reproductive Technologies (ART)
Assisted reproductive technologies like in vitro fertilization (IVF) have expanded options for women seeking pregnancy later in life. Yet even ART has its limits tied closely to egg quality and quantity.
Women over 40 often face lower success rates with their own eggs due to diminished ovarian reserve and increased chromosomal abnormalities. Using donor eggs from younger women significantly improves outcomes for older recipients but raises ethical and emotional considerations.
ART cannot fully overcome natural biological boundaries but can extend reproductive possibilities beyond what was historically possible.
The Impact of Health and Lifestyle on Fertility Longevity
Age isn’t the only factor determining when women stop having kids naturally. Lifestyle choices and overall health play crucial roles in maintaining fertility longer or accelerating its decline.
- Smoking: Accelerates ovarian aging by reducing blood flow and increasing oxidative stress on eggs.
- BMI: Both underweight and obesity disrupt hormonal balance affecting ovulation.
- Chronic conditions: Diseases like diabetes or autoimmune disorders can impair reproductive function.
- Nutritional status: Deficiencies in key nutrients such as folate and vitamin D impact egg health.
- Stress: Chronic stress interferes with hormonal signaling critical for ovulation.
- Toxin exposure: Chemicals like pesticides or endocrine disruptors may harm fertility over time.
Maintaining a healthy lifestyle can delay some effects of aging on fertility but cannot completely halt them.
The Importance of Regular Gynecological Care
Routine gynecological exams help monitor reproductive health through pelvic ultrasounds, hormone level testing, and ovarian reserve assessments like anti-Müllerian hormone (AMH) measurement.
Early detection of declining ovarian function allows informed family planning decisions before fertility becomes severely compromised.
The Science Behind Egg Aging and Its Consequences
Egg aging involves both quantitative loss (fewer eggs) and qualitative deterioration (increased DNA damage). Older eggs have higher incidences of chromosomal abnormalities such as aneuploidy—leading causes of miscarriage or genetic disorders like Down syndrome.
Mitochondrial dysfunction within aging oocytes reduces energy supply necessary for fertilization and embryo development. These cellular changes explain why pregnancy complications rise with maternal age.
Unlike sperm production—which continues throughout most men’s lives—women’s egg production is fixed at birth. This fundamental difference underscores why “What Age Can Women Stop Having Kids?” is primarily a question about biological limits rather than personal choice alone.
The Role of Menstrual Cycle Changes in Fertility Decline
As women approach their late 30s and early 40s, menstrual cycles often become irregular due to fluctuating hormone levels. Shorter or skipped cycles indicate fewer ovulatory events reducing opportunities for conception each month.
Tracking these cycle changes provides clues about declining fertility even before menopause onset.
The Role of Egg Freezing as a Fertility Preservation Strategy
Egg freezing has gained popularity as a way to “pause” fertility decline by harvesting eggs at a younger age for future use. This option offers hope but comes with caveats:
- No guarantee all frozen eggs will result in pregnancy later.
- Certain costs involved which may not be covered by insurance.
- The procedure works best if done before significant ovarian aging sets in—ideally before mid-30s.
Egg freezing doesn’t change “What Age Can Women Stop Having Kids?” biologically but provides more control over timing through technology.
Tackling Myths Around Late-Age Pregnancy Possibilities
There’s plenty of misinformation floating around regarding late-age pregnancies:
- “Women can get pregnant naturally well into their 50s.”
While rare cases exist due to delayed menopause or irregular ovulation, natural conception past mid-40s is extremely uncommon without medical intervention.
- “Hormone supplements can restore full fertility.”
Hormonal therapies may regulate cycles temporarily but cannot reverse egg aging or restore ovarian reserve significantly enough for natural conception at advanced ages.
- “Lifestyle changes alone can stop fertility decline.”
Healthy habits support reproductive health but do not halt biological aging processes responsible for reduced fecundity over time.
Understanding these facts helps set realistic expectations aligned with scientific evidence rather than wishful thinking or hearsay.
